Richard is a self-taught photographer and portrait artist in pastel and charcoal. His wildflower photography brings the viewer nose to nose with the intricate details and the dazzling colors of the wildflowers of Texas. His photography provides a front row seat, a vantage point like none other, to the spectacular beauty showered upon us every spring in Texas.
His interest in portrait art caught fire in 1999 after a 25 year hiatus from art. Looking for subject matter for his art, he stumbled into sketching faces. His passion for portrait art has produced the realization that every face is worth a portrait. In the past two years, three of Richard's portraits have won first place ribbons at shows sponsored by the Medina Valley Art Society. And, a portrait entry in 2003 has been selected for KLRN's "Studio 9 Collection." Richard welcomes portrait commissions.
